当前位置:  开发笔记 > 前端 > 正文

使用标准的Windows命令行/批处理命令模拟unix'cut'

如何解决《使用标准的Windows命令行/批处理命令模拟unix'cut'》经验,为你挑选了1个好方法。

有没有办法在Windows XP上模拟unix cut命令,而不使用cygwin或其他非标准的Windows功能?

示例:使用tasklist/v,通过窗口标题查找特定任务,然后从该列表中提取PID以传递给taskkill.



1> Wedge..:

仅供参考,任务列表和taskkill已具备过滤功能:

tasklist /FI "imagename eq chrome.exe"
taskkill /F /FI "imagename eq iexplore.exe"

如果您想要更多通用功能,批处理脚本(ugh)可以提供帮助.例如:

for /f "tokens=1,2 delims= " %%i in ('tasklist /v') do (
  if "%%i" == "%~1" (
    echo TASKKILL /PID %%j
  )
)

windows命令行有相当多的帮助.键入"help"以获取带有简单摘要的命令列表,然后键入"help"以获取有关该命令的更多信息(例如"help for").

推荐阅读
惬听风吟jyy_802
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有